Having seen lovely spring bulb photos on FB from a local friend, I started exploring this special Botanical Garden in North Georgia: Gibbs Gardens Avoiding the Easter weekend due to the crowds on the road as well as here at the Gardens, we booked a ticket on line for April 8. Very easy, having our Senior Admission on our iPhone... we were in! At the welcome center we were greeted by the friendly resident kitty Spot and he was easy to cuddle with.
